I have a MBP 2018 with Vega 20 and two 5K ultra-fine LG monitors – and a Magic Mouse 2.
All works surprisingly well and fast, except a scrolling issue with the Magic Mouse 2.

The scrolling up and down gets stuck or is erratic. It is not the mouse – it has been replaced by Apple and this one, and previous one, work well with another MBP 2012 that I have. Also – after mouse use, in Safari, there is some jumping around of the image – even when nothing is touched until it stabilizes.

1) The Bluetooth has been reset – the BT plist files deleted regenerated

2) PRAM and SMC have been reset

3) Mojave – latest OSX has been reinstalled

4) I also have the BT magic track 2 and it works fine (as does the built in pad)

5) Mice (magic mouse 2) (2 of them) has been removed from BT settings and re-added a few times.

6) Happens in all applications – however I run parallels on this MBP and on the Windows 10 virtual machine it appears to be OK

I have seen some reports on MBP2018 magic Mouse 2 issues, mostly during the Mojave Beta, but the issues were disconnect and right click, both of which work OK in my setup.

I suspect Blue tooth 5 drivers in Mojave have issues with Apple Magic Mouse 2. Apple support (have reached level 2) does not appear to have a clue. Anyone else has issues like this one? Anything else to try (other than the obvious, do not use this mouse)?
